Jogging routes around Mornago, Italy, traverse a region characterized by its proximity to natural parks and scenic lakes. The area offers a mix of terrain, from the generally flat paths around Lake Varese to the more varied trails within the Campo dei Fiori Regional Park. Runners can explore chestnut and beech forests, as well as local paths that wind through diverse landscapes. This environment provides a rewarding destination for various running preferences.

Mornago offers a varied landscape for running. You can find generally flat paths, such as those around Lake Varese, ideal for relaxed jogs. There are also more challenging trails within the Campo dei Fiori Regional Park, characterized by chestnut and beech forests, providing opportunities for trail running.
Yes, Mornago offers options for all fitness levels. While many routes are moderate, there is at least one easy route available. For a pleasant, steady run, consider the Laghetto dul Peder loop from Sumirago, which is a moderate 3.5 miles (5.7 km) path featuring a loop around a small lake.
Absolutely. For those looking for a longer run, the Scenic view of Lake Comabbio loop from Mornago is a challenging 15.4 miles (24.7 km) route offering expansive views. This route is one of the most popular long-distance options in the area.
Yes, many of the running routes in Mornago are designed as loops. For example, the Piana di Vegonno loop from Sumirago is a 6.9 miles (11.1 km) trail that leads through varied landscapes, perfect for a circular run.
The region around Mornago is rich in natural beauty. You can enjoy scenic views of Lake Comabbio on some routes. The broader Varese area also features natural parks like Campo dei Fiori, offering diverse flora and fauna. You might also encounter unique geological formations like the 'Marmitte dei giganti' or the 'Fonte del Ceppo' spring within the regional park.
Yes, the area offers historical points of interest. For instance, the Castelseprio Archaeological Park is a notable historical site in the vicinity. While running, you might also pass through charming local villages with their own unique character.

The elevation gain varies significantly depending on the route. Flatter routes, like the Running loop from Crugnola, have minimal elevation changes, around 50 meters. More challenging routes, such as the Scenic view of Lake Comabbio loop, can have an elevation gain of over 470 meters, offering a more strenuous workout.
